U.S. Postal Service Announces New Prices for 2023

USPS-shipping-prices-2023

The U.S. Postal Service has filed notice with the Postal Regulatory Commission (PRC) of price changes for shipping services scheduled to take effect January 22, 2023. The proposed prices were approved by the Postal Service governors.

Notably, there is no price increase for Parcel Select Ground, and the pricing for USPS Connect Local will also remain unchanged. In addition, some Priority Mail flat-rate retail product prices will be reduced (compared with the temporary rate adjustment currently in place).

Priority Mail commercial rates will increase by 3.6 percent. Overall, Priority Mail service prices would increase approximately 5.5 percent; Priority Mail Express service prices would increase by 6.6 percent; and First-Class Package Service prices would increase by 7.8 percent. The PRC will review prices before they are scheduled to take effect.

The proposed domestic Priority Mail Flat Rate retail price changes are:

Product  Current  Planned Change
Small flat-rate box$10.40$10.20
Medium flat-rate box$17.05$17.10
Large flat-rate box$22.45$22.80
APO/FPO large flat-rate box$20.95$21.20
Regular flat-rate envelope$ 9.90$ 9.65
Legal flat-rate envelope$10.20$ 9.95
Padded flat-rate envelope$10.60$10.40
